Hotel Description

Located close to the beach, Los Suenos Marriott Ocean & Golf Resort is a great retreat. With nearby hiking, golf, tennis, volleyball, on-site swimming pool and more, guests won't have to travel far to enjoy recreational activities. The hotel also has nice on-site restaurants, including a pub. More

Beautiful but not for little kids
By Margaret O, 3/22/09
This place is expensive - they do overcharge. but the people are so nice and everything is very clean. the pool is fabulous. However, the kids club is for kids aged 4 to 12 and from 10am to 12am and then 2pm to 4pm. But, when my daughter went to the kids club she was the only kid in there - maybe it was a down week, but there weren't a ton of other kids to play with. Also, the tours are not geared for kids. You can take your kids - I think they would have let my 2 year do the zip line...but again, they are not designed with kids in mind and you won't have too much fun on the tours if you bring young children. The jungle tour (Carara) was basically bird watching which was entirely boring for my 6 and under crowd. The boat ride to see birds and crocodiles was fun for them and 'relatively' safe (you need to keep a hold on the little ones as there are no seat belts and lower sides on the boats.) Also - if you need a sitter - they provide VERY qualified (cpr, etc.) sitters, but 24 hours notice is not enough, even though they told us it was. If you think you might even want a sitter, book them WAY IN ADVANCE and then cancel if you have to. By the way - the pool is great. there is a baby pool that is about 18 inches deep. the big pool is 4' all over with lots of places to enter/exit that have WIDE steps. A good place for little ones to hang out too. But, if you don't have kids that are good swimmers, its hard for you/them to swim here because you have to hold them up - as its so deep. The taxi ride (we used their service -CRT) was as comfortable as it gets, but is still a grueling 2 hour ride, especially if you have just flown a long way into San Jose. It makes for a VERY long day.

Once was enough
By A Yahoo! Contributor, 2/14/09
This hotel has many positives such as the beautiful clean pool and swim up bar. Food was excellent and the staff very helpful. Rooms and beds were great, the best we've had out of the country. Now for the negatives; it's isolated from the rest of Costa Rica, a mountainous 2 hour drive from San Jose. Carrara Park was disappointing (but we couldn't get a guide at mid-day so didn't see anything, maybe go early or late). Hotel is full of Americans, and we were looking for a more cultural experience. Beach isn't the best, rocky. Also, beware the many hotel charges for "extras" such as the $7.50 bottle of Evian in the room and the $14 daily charge for internet. You can go to the grocery store on the way into Los Suenos and buy water and snacks for next to nothing; ask your driver to stop there. Also, since our cell phones didn't work here, even though we had service everywhere else we visited in Costa Rica, we had to use the hotel phones. Biggest rip off was the tour desk. We paid $76 per person for a safari ride that you can drive or taxi to; it costs $20 per person without the hotel's shuttle service! Visit Jaco next town over but beware at night; it gets creepy on the side streets (security guards protect the cars parked at local restaurants). We enjoyed our 3 days there since we were tired from touring the rest of the country but don't feel like we saw much of Costa Rica and wouldn't return unless we wanted a destination resort experience.

They Nickel and Dime You To Death
By A Yahoo! Contributor, 8/25/08
I was so sick of the over charge at this resort. The service was amazing. The fees were ridiculous. Don't pay 7.00 for a Evian, don't do the tours through the hotel, go to Jaco and book through a tour through and independant operator. Use Taxi Aeropuerto for a ride to the airport at half the price of the Marriott. The property was amazing but the prices at the hotel ridiculous even for a resort
